Creating with Intention: How to Maximize Every Corner
Among the most effective strategies for making a tiny room feel larger is to offer every product a particular purpose-- and preferably, greater than one. For instance, a storage footrest can work as a coffee table, extra seats, and a location to hide coverings or games. A bench by the entryway could double as footwear storage and a spot to rest while putting them on.
Color and light also play a significant duty in multifunctional areas. Lighter tones can help an area feel even more open, while tactical lights highlights functional locations and creates aesthetic balance. Mirrors can show light and make a room feel two times its size, specifically when placed near home windows or lights.
Multifunctionality isn't practically specific pieces-- it's likewise concerning flow. The format of a space need to make it easy to change from one task to another without major disturbance. That might imply picking light-weight furniture that's simple to relocate, or making use of drapes and folding displays to separate spaces briefly.
Smart Furniture Choices for Small Living
Furnishings can either make or damage a multifunctional room. Selecting the best pieces is crucial, especially try here when your goal is to blend comfort and function without overwhelming the space. Purchasing a couple of high-quality items that are adaptable will pay off in everyday benefit.
Search for products that provide hidden compartments, like sofas with under-seat storage or beds that raise to disclose room below. A drop-leaf table can be broadened for visitors or folded up down when not being used, making it suitable for smaller sized homes. If you take pleasure in holding, think about a sleeper sofa or a daybed that easily transitions right into a resting area without compromising your layout.
